Get ready to celebrate Youth Week 2025 with our Shire of Denmark Youth Fest, supported by the Department of Communities, held on Wednesday, 16th April, 2025, from 11am to 3pm at the McLean Sports Precinct near the skate park.

 

Running from the 10th to the 17th of April, Youth Week WA 2025 is an opportunity for young people aged 10-25 to be recognised for their valuable contributions to the social, cultural, and economic life of Western Australia.

 

This year's theme, "Our Threads, This Place, Your Moment," encourages youth to express their ideas, showcase their talents, raise awareness about important issues, and connect with their peers and the wider community.

 

This year’s exciting, all-ages Youth Fest event features a variety of activities and attractions, including:

  • Arts and Crafts by War on Waste
  • Skateboard Competition by Denmark Skate Inc
  • Lego Stations
  • Lawn Games
  • Mini Golf by Par Tee Golf
  • Photobooth by Ace Camera Club
  • Face Painting by MIKI
  • Chill Out Sensory Zone
  • Have a Go Aerials and Mini Tramp by Southern Edge Arts

 

In addition to these fun activities, we will have support agencies such as AYSA, Palmerston, and Holyoak, as well as our own Shire Rangers on-site, providing education and information to our youth and their parents.

 

At our listening posts, our Shire Councillors and the Denmark CRC will be available to hear our young community members’ thoughts and ideas about the future of our community and several competitions will run throughout the day, including our competition to name the Shire of Denmark’s Youth Strategy.
